Output dd263f19da5c98f5aa1b33226e65c17fa44c0fb47d04af82eda3370ca18ebbcc:17

value
525335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b8036a432569d2dc96b33b32c99eebee3d18d3 OP_EQUAL
address
33wiacqaGuyAp9K7TBxf8Vj6RqMh7NYHGB
transaction
dd263f19da5c98f5aa1b33226e65c17fa44c0fb47d04af82eda3370ca18ebbcc
spent
true